Inserting Effects on an Input or Track Channel
1. Select the group of channels that contains the desired input or track channel by
pressing its FADER button.
2. Press the desired channel’s CH EDIT button.
3. Select the FX INS parameter—the ENTER/YES button begins to flash.
4. Press ENTER/YES, or press PAGE and then F1 (FX Ins), to display the EFFECT
INSERT screen.
Each processor has its own set of insert controls. You
can select any available effect processor—depending on
the patch you want to use (Page 216)—and insert it on
the current input or track channel.
Each of the effect processors is a stereo processor with
left and right sides. You can insert both sides of an
effect, one or the other, or both sides one-after-another,
as explained below.
5. Select an effect’s insert assign switch and turn the Time/Value dial to select the desired
insert routing. You can select OFF, so that the effect isn’t inserted on the channel, or you
can select:
When you select an insert routing, a symbol representing the processor’s currently
selected effect patch appears to show you the effect you’ve inserted. Lines in and out of
the symbol show the selected signal flow in and out of the inserted effect.
If a processor is tied up elsewhere, you’ll see an arrow pointing to the input or track
channel it’s inserted on, as with Effect 3 above. To change this assignment, press CH
EDIT for the channel on which it’s inserted to access its EFFECT INSERT screen.
The INSERT EFFECT section of the VGA’s CH EDIT screen—Page 210—also shows the
routing of each effect inserted on the channel.
